§ 231:62-a — Terms of 2 or 3 Years

I.At any annual town meeting under an article in the warrant placed there by petition or by the selectmen, the voters may vote, by ballot, to determine if they are in favor of having a 2 or 3-year term for each town highway agent. If a majority of those voting on the question vote in favor of a longer term, at the next annual meeting after the vote of approval, the town shall choose, by ballot, or the selectmen shall appoint, one or more town agents for the designated term of years.
